Understanding Sildenafil Side Effects and Proper Usage
How to Take Sildenafil Correctly
Sildenafil should be taken approximately 30-60 minutes before planned sexual activity. The typical starting dose is 50mg, though your prescriber may recommend 25mg or 100mg depending on your individual circumstances. Swallow the tablet whole with water, and remember that sexual stimulation is still required for the medication to work effectively.
Common Sildenafil Side Effects
Most men tolerate sildenafil well, but some may experience mild side effects. The most frequently reported include headache, facial flushing, indigestion, nasal congestion, and dizziness. These effects are usually temporary and resolve as the medication leaves your system. If side effects persist or become bothersome, consult your healthcare provider about adjusting your dose.
Serious Side Effects Requiring Immediate Medical Attention
Whilst rare, some side effects require urgent medical care. Seek immediate help if you experience chest pain, sudden vision or hearing loss, or an erection lasting more than 4 hours. These situations are medical emergencies. Additionally, if you develop severe allergic reactions such as difficulty breathing or swelling of face and throat, call 999 immediately.
Factors Affecting Sildenafil Effectiveness
Several factors can influence how well sildenafil works. Large or fatty meals may delay the onset of action, so consider taking it on a relatively empty stomach. Excessive alcohol consumption can reduce effectiveness and increase the risk of side effects. Who Should Avoid Sildenafil
Sildenafil is not suitable for everyone. Men taking nitrate medications for chest pain must not use sildenafil due to dangerous blood pressure interactions. Those with severe heart conditions, recent stroke or heart attack, or severe liver problems should discuss alternative treatments with their prescriber.
